To begin with this particular recipe, we have to first prepare a few components. You can have filipino beef steak using 7 ingredients and 7 steps. Here is how you cook it.

The ingredients needed to make Filipino Beef Steak:

  1. Get Thin slices of beef steak
  2. Make ready Large Onions
  3. Prepare 2 Lemons
  4. Get Brown Sugar
  5. Take Soy Sauce
  6. Get Garlic
  7. Make ready Corn starch

Steps to make Filipino Beef Steak:

  1. Marinate beef steak slices in soy sauce and pepper. Squeeze out juice from the lemons to the marinade. Add brown sugar
  2. Marinate for an hour
  3. Heat pan with cooking oil and fry the beef slices without the marinade until they turn brown. Set aside.
  4. In the same pan, saute the onions cut in circular shape. Set aside.
  5. Saute chopped garlic. Add the marinade and then the beef steak. Cook until meat is tender
  6. Dissolve a teaspoon of corn starch in water, then add to the mixture.
  7. Add onions on top of the tenderized beef steak.

Bistek or Bistek Tagalog is a Filipino version beef steak marinated in soy sauce and kalamansi When I was a kid, I thought that 'Bistek" is a Filipino way of tagalizing the English word "beefsteak".
